gossypol and Hypospermatogenesis

gossypol has been researched along with Hypospermatogenesis in 9 studies

Gossypol: A dimeric sesquiterpene found in cottonseed (GOSSYPIUM). The (-) isomer is active as a male contraceptive (CONTRACEPTIVE AGENTS, MALE) whereas toxic symptoms are associated with the (+) isomer.

" Experiments conducted on Sprague-Dawley rats and cynomolgous monkeys confirm that either (-) or (+) gossypol is too toxic to be developed for human contraception."2.40Gossypol: reasons for its failure to be accepted as a safe, reversible male antifertility drug. "Gossypol acetic acid was administered orally to 35 male volunteers at a dose of 20 mg once a day for 52-70 days in the loading phase and twice a week for 22 months in the maintenance phase."1.28Relationship between hormone profiles and the restoration of spermatogenesis in men treated with gossypol.
